As an educator I have met out many different types of punishments to the students in my class. Coming up with ingenious ways to deal with the 42 kids daily is quite a challenge for me.
Let me share with you the 10-10 classroom rule which I have that has been very effect since I started impementing it this year.
I have a very hyperactive and sometimes often boisterous bunch of students. It takes them some time to settle down when they endter the classroom.
I was getting very annoyed with them one day for taking quite a long while to settle down.
” By the time I count to ten I want all of you settled down at your seat with your textbooks open” I said.
After giving them the instruction I started counting down. When I got to 10 the last two boys scrambled to get their textbooks out.
Before starting on the lesson that day I told them I was very upset with them wasting out precious lesson time. And from now onwards , everytime they wasted time they would have to repay the time that they owed me.
“So what are you going to do with us? ” asked one of students with a smirk on his face.
I smiled back at him and deliberately talked slower.
” For every 10 seconds that you waste you repay me with 10 minutes “
It felt great seeing his jaw drop when he heard my reply.
From that day onwards I just had to write 10 seconds = 10 minutes on the board and the students would immediately speed up and stop dilly dallying.
